[N11720] H. Stephen Nye
Nov. 17, 1942 - Sept. 8, 2014

SOUTH BEND - H. Stephen Nye, 71, of South Bend, Indiana, passed away at 12:55 a.m. Monday, September 8, 2014, in Morning View Nursing and Rehabilitation Center. Stephen was born on November 17, 1942, in Buffalo, New York, to Harry and Bernice (Zamorski) Nye, and had lived in South Bend since he was seven years old. Stephen was the owner of EIS Environmental Engineers in South Bend. On April 3, 1998, at Diamondhead, Waikiki, Hawaii, on a sailboat, at sunset, he married Judy K. Heritz, who survives. Also surviving are two daughters, Dawn Nye of South Bend, Indiana, and Jamie (Brian) Downs of Batavia, Ohio; two sons, Todd (Rochelle) Nye of Durham, North Carolina, & Jason Heritz of Nappanee, Indiana; six grandchildren, Cameron Nye, McKayle Nye, Collin Heritz, Ariana Downs, Rachel Downs and Gabriel Downs; two sisters, Mary Lou (Larry) Vadas-Salyers of Charlotte, North Carolina, and Barbara (Ken) Johnston of South Bend, Indiana; two brothers, David (Penny) Nye and Chris (Mary) Nye of Naperville, Illinois. A private Mass will be held at a later date. Stephen was a 1960 graduate of St. Joseph High School. He received his Bachelor of Science Degree from I.U. Bloomington and Master's Degree from the University of Notre Dame. He received a P.E. (Professional Engineer Certificate) from the State of Indiana. He was a Past Chair of the Independent Harbor Group, New Buffalo, Michigan, and Past Chair of Computer Information Services Advisory Board at Ivy Tech Community College. He was a Class D Certified Wastewater Treatment Operator and a Certified RAB Environmental Provisional Auditor. Stephen was a life member of the United States Sail and Power Squadron. He was a licensed multi-engine instrument rated pilot, a licensed Ham Radio operator and amateur photographer. Stephen was an avid sailor, scuba diver, snow skier, body builder, and loved to make gourmet food with his wife and travel. Stephen was an amazing businessman, friend, husband and family man, and very proud of his children and grandchildren. Memorial contributions may be made to the Alzheimer's and Dementia Services of Northern Indiana or Harbor Light Hospice. Kaniewski Funeral Home is in charge of arrangements.
